Re: electric motor speed:

I have a dual-speed electric motor from an old washing machine on my
extractor. A single pole double throw (SPDT) switch selects high or low
speed, from the same motor. Used originally to select normal or gentle
wash action.
Allows me to start out slow with the full frames and then go to full
speed at the flip of a switch. No additional belts or gearing to select
those two speeds.

Might be of interest to a creaming operation as well.
